What are the different breed coat colors in your program?
Our Boston Terrier puppies include seal and white, seal brindle and white, brindle and white, black brindle and white, and black and white. French Bulldog puppies are cream. Colors will vary depending on the parent dogs.

DNA Disease Panel
Genetic testing reduces the chance of passing down a wide variety of hereditary diseases of differing prevalence and severity such as Progressive Retinal Atrophy (an eye disease) and Von Willebrand's Disease (a blood disease).
